Ogier advises Hipgnosis Songs Fund on US $700 million group financing

Ogier’s corporate and funds advisers in Guernsey have assisted long-standing client, and music fund, Hipgnosis Songs Fund Limited with financing of US $700 million.

Hipgnosis Songs Fund, launched in 2018, is a Guernsey registered investment company listed on the FTSE 250 Index, and is the first UK-listed investment company offering investors a pure-play exposure to songs and associated musical intellectual property rights.

The fund receives royalty payments every time one of its songs is played on radio, streamed, featured in media or purchased.

Hipgnosis was founded by Merck Mercuriadis, the former manager of globally successful recording artists such as Beyoncé, Elton John, Morrissey, Iron Maiden and Guns N’ Roses.

Working with onshore counsel Herbert Smith Freehills LLP, the corporate and funds team provided Guernsey law advice on various aspects of the financing, which will be used to refinance the previous facility and for working capital. Hipgnosis Songs Fund’s portfolio of more than 65,000 songs includes those made famous by the likes of Shawn Mendes, One Direction, and Metallica.

“We were delighted to continue to support Hipgnosis and to have finalised this financing for Hipgnosis Songs Fund. We are looking forward to seeing its continued success this year, and in 2023,” said partner Tim Clipstone (pictured), who headed up a team including managing associate Michelle Watson Bunn, senior associate Diana Collas and trainee solicitor James Hewlett.
